I recall asking this question not too long ago (please don''t ask me to find the original post), but those that glow red have chromium (they may have vanadium too, but they also have chromium). The ones strictly colored by vanadium do not glow red. The strange thing about that is that my tsavorite does not glow red under the UV lighting, but it does under my chelsea filter (????). My lighter grossular green garnet, glows an eerie pink!!
32.gif
The experts told me that was due to chromium content in the stone.

Arcadian,
The chelsea filter is to check for chromium. Some tsavorites are coloured by only chromium, some only by vanadium, and some a combination of both. It seems that your new tsav has only vanadium as its colouring agent.
